Popular Girl Names Starting With Ser
Many girl names starting with "Ser" have gained popularity over the years due to their melodic sound and rich meanings. Here are some of the most beloved and widely used options:
- Serena – Derived from Latin, meaning "tranquil" or "serene." This name exudes calmness and grace, making it a timeless choice.
- Seraphina – Of Hebrew origin, meaning "fiery" or "ardent," and related to the angelic beings called seraphim. It carries a sense of spirituality and elegance.
- Sera – A shorter, sweet form of Serena or Seraphina, meaning "evening" in Latin or "to watch" in Hebrew, depending on the origin.
- Sereia – A Portuguese name meaning "mermaid," perfect for parents seeking a whimsical and ocean-inspired name.
- Seren – A Welsh name meaning "star," offering a celestial vibe with a modern touch.
Unique and Rare Girl Names Starting With Ser
If you're seeking distinctive names that stand out, consider these rare and charming options starting with "Ser":
- Serafina – An elegant variation of Seraphina, adding an extra touch of sophistication and rarity.
- Serenella – Of Italian origin, meaning "little star," perfect for a girl destined to shine brightly.
- Serilda – Of Germanic roots, meaning "armed maiden," conveying strength and resilience.
- Seraphine – A French variation of Seraphina, offering an artistic and vintage appeal.
- Serenita – Derived from "serenity," this name embodies peace and calmness in a unique form.

Historical and Cultural Significance
Many "Ser" names have rich historical and cultural backgrounds, making them meaningful choices for parents interested in heritage. For example:
- Seraphina – Rooted in religious texts and angelic hierarchies, symbolizing purity and divine protection.
- Serilda – With Germanic origins, associated with legendary tales of warrior maidens and strength.
- Seren – Celebrated in Welsh culture as a poetic and celestial name, representing a shining star or hope.
